On the GCAMP Calendar of Events you will find:

  • Career/Job Fairs – These are hiring events, often held in anticipation of an upcoming high school or community college graduation, meant to help graduating students find jobs.   Manufacturers - find your next employees here!
  • Career Expos - (also sometimes called Showcases or Trades Fairs) These events are slightly different from job fairs.   They are geared towards younger students to encourage them to pursue a career in industry.   The students at these events are not seeking jobs yet, but they are looking for information about possibly pursuing careers in industry.   Manufacturers are invited to these events to introduce the next generation to the field of manufacturing. 
  • Mock Interviews -These events are for students to learn interviewing skills.  Industry professionals are needed to help conduct the mock interviews, and employers sometimes find potential real-life hires at mock interviews.
  • Advisory Meetings – These meetings allow industry experts an opportunity to give their input on how educators can refine their programs for current trends and technology.  These are great events to connect industry with education.
  • Competition Judge Requests – Student skills competitions are great ways for members of industry to meet skilled students and educators.  Plus, they are often a fun way for those in industry to volunteer their time and give back to the community. 
  • Awards & Scholarships - Awards refer to contests or competitions for people, frequently students, in manufacturing.  Scholarships on our page are for students to help fund their education beyond high school.   See the scholarship descriptions for more details.

Machine Tool Technology Advisory Board Meeting

The Industry and Technology Division at Waubonsee Community College invites you to attend an Advisory Committee meeting in support of the certificate and degree programs in the Machine Tool Technology Program.  We are seeking your input regarding best practices in the field, equipment and technology needs for the program, and the skills and/or credentials you are seeking in employment candidates.  One of the key discussions will involve potentially shifting from NIMS accreditation to SACA certifications. Your feedback is critical for the success of our students. Please consider joining us or sending a representative from your organization.  Visit our website for more details about this program: Machine Tool Technology
